Martin Montoya, former of both Barcelona and Inter Milan, spoke about the’upcoming challenge between the blaugrana and nerazzurri. “I expect a very balanced double challenge – he told TuttoMercatoWeb -. Barça, respecting its characteristics, will try to control the game and have possession of the ball. This’Inter will play it, but for me in the end Barcelona will pass”.

So he had his say between Lautaro Martinez and Lamine Yamal: “Lautaro and Lamine are decisive players who can win you a game at any time. The Argentine is a goleador and the Spaniard has that magic that can give you assists and goals. If I have to choose, however, I bet on Yamal”.

On his experience in the Nerazzurri: “The only thing I would change about my time at Inter is that I would enjoy my time in Milan more. Unfortunately, I did not have the trust of coach Mancini, they gave me almost no opportunities to prove my worth. I stayed at Inter only six months, but despite this I still maintain beautiful memories of the Nerazzurri club and, more generally, of the Serie A championship”.

Closing on Betis-Fiorentina, Conference League semifinal: “It will be a very nice game to watch: both teams play very good soccer and I think there will be a lot of goals, but the Benito Villamarín will be a deciding factor. I think, again, Betis has a better chance of going to the final”.
